Garage Shelves Installation in Montgomery County, MD
Garage shelves installation services focus on creating organized storage solutions within residential garages. This service covers a range of projects, including the installation of wall-mounted shelves, free-standing units, and custom shelving systems to maximize space and improve accessibility. Property owners often request garage shelving to better store tools, sports equipment, seasonal items, or household supplies, helping to reduce clutter and enhance overall organization.
Before requesting garage shelves installation, homeowners typically want to understand the types of shelving options available, the materials used, and how the installation process will integrate with existing garage layouts. It’s also helpful to consider the weight capacity needed for stored items and any specific preferences for accessibility or aesthetics. Clarifying these details can ensure the shelving system meets the storage needs and complements the garage’s design.

Garage Shelves Installation Questions
What types of garage shelves can be installed? Various options include wall-mounted, freestanding, and adjustable shelving to suit different storage needs and garage layouts.
Are garage shelves suitable for heavy items? Yes, many garage shelving systems are designed to hold heavy tools, equipment, and storage bins securely.
Can garage shelves be customized to fit specific spaces? Customizable shelving solutions can be tailored to fit unique garage dimensions and storage requirements.
What materials are commonly used for garage shelves? Common materials include metal, wood, and durable plastic, each offering different strengths and aesthetic options.
